We spent Wednesday 8/24 - Sunday 8/28 at the park. It was awesome, great walking trails, and lots of pavement to walk on as well. Alice was a great camp host, and very accommodating, and welcoming.
Good place to go hiking through out the year. The hunting area isn’t near the hiking trails. You can do some small trails or a larger loop that is about 5.5 miles long. Some of the trails need a little work and to be cleaned but it was a nice day hike.
This is one of my favorite Illinois State Parks. The camp hosts are super nice and helpful. I like staying during the week, it’s almost always practically empty. There are awesome heavily wooded and beautiful trails. The campsites are spacious, level with electric 30 amp hookup, fire pits and picnic tables.
I’ve been coming here for almost 20 years and I love this place. The campground is great and the sites are private and the hiking trails are always good.
